Key ceremony checklist — item 7 (on-call)

[ ] Before signing the release of the Huemark contrast-audit toolkit, confirm both custodians are present and the audit report (WCAG ratios for all themes) is attached to the ceremony record. Unlock the signing module only after the witness initials the log; at the prompt, enter the passphrase below.

recovery phrase for yaweg-tafof: zorvan-eliiel-zoriel-oliir-tamax-zordor

## Break-Glass Access — GateTally Turnstile Counter

If GateTally stops reporting entries mid-event at Harrowfield Arena, support can bypass the normal admin login. Use the break-glass console on the ops kiosk, confirm with the duty lead first, and log it in the shift notes afterward — no exceptions. The console will prompt you for the emergency passphrase, which is:

strongbox words: zordor-quenax

**Vendor note: Inkmill markdown pipeline**

Rendering for Parchway docs is outsourced to Inkmill under an annual contract, renewing each March. They handle sanitization and PDF export; we own the upload queue. SLA: 4-hour response on rendering failures. Escalate only after two failed retries. Their support desk is reachable at the address below.

billing contact of hahaf-baguf = zorael.tammir.jorius@sivrelhq.internal

## Idempotency Keys for Payment Retries (Lumopay)

Every retry of a charge request must reuse the original idempotency key; generating a new key on retry can produce duplicate charges. Keys are scoped per merchant and expire after 48 hours. Reviewers should verify keys are derived server-side, never from client input. The full key-generation specification and threat model are maintained on the internal page.

dashboard of kaguf-tawip = https://vault.merlaqsys.test/issue